What Is DASF 2.0?
The Databricks AI Security Framework (DASF) was developed to address AI-specific risks through a defense-in-depth approach. Version 2.0 expands with 64 controls covering 62 risks, delivering advanced protections and enhanced compliance alignment with evolving governance standards. By bridging security, data science, and IT teams, DASF 2.0 helps organizations securely deploy AI while maximizing impact.
How AppSOC Enhances Databricks Security
AppSOC’s deep integration with DASF 2.0 delivers comprehensive security across AI development and deployment phases:
- AI Discovery: Automated discovery of models, datasets, and workflows ensures continuous visibility and compliance.
- AI Security Testing: Continuous scanning and automated Red Teaming proactively identify vulnerabilities.
- Security Posture Management: Detects and mitigates misconfigurations, model theft risks, and access control issues before they escalate.
- Runtime Enforcement: Real-time threat detection and automated remediation guard against prompt injections, malicious code, and data leaks.
- Governance and Compliance: Simplifies regulatory adherence by mapping security findings directly to DASF 2.0 controls.
